What is a senior root cause analysis specialist?

A Senior Root Cause Analysis (RCA) specialist is an experienced professional who investigates and identifies the underlying causes of problems or incidents within an organization. Their primary goal is to analyze complex issues, utilize various RCA methodologies (such as the 5 Whys, Fishbone Diagram, or Fault Tree Analysis), and recommend effective solutions to prevent recurrence. They often work across different departments, lead RCA investigations, and provide guidance and training to other team members. Senior RCA specialists play a critical role in improving processes, enhancing safety, and minimizing risks.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a senior root cause analysis specialist?

To thrive as a Senior Root Cause Analysis Specialist, you need expertise in problem-solving methodologies, data analysis, and process improvement, often backed by a degree in engineering, quality management, or a related field. Familiarity with tools like Six Sigma, Fishbone diagrams, 5 Whys, and data visualization software is typically required, along with relevant certifications such as Six Sigma Black Belt or Lean. Strong analytical thinking, communication, and cross-functional collaboration skills help professionals effectively identify issues and drive corrective actions. These skills are crucial for uncovering underlying problems, preventing recurrence, and supporting continuous improvement within organizations.

How does a senior root cause analysis specialist typically collaborate with cross-functional teams to resolve complex issues?

A Senior Root Cause Analysis specialist often works closely with engineers, quality assurance, operations, and management teams to thoroughly investigate incidents or recurring problems. They lead structured problem-solving sessions, facilitate data collection, and coordinate follow-up actions to ensure that solutions address the underlying causes. Effective collaboration is key, as these specialists must communicate findings clearly and drive consensus on corrective actions across different departments. This role frequently involves presenting detailed analysis to leadership and mentoring less experienced team members in best practices.
